Product Description

Cleanoz was developed by a Pediatric ENT (Ear, Nose & Throat Specialist) for the special needs of newborns, infants and toddlers. Its innovative, hygienic design and technically-advanced features make breathing easier by providing a fast, efficient and safe way to clear baby's nasal passages. It's ergonomic design also makes it much easier and more convenient for parents to use. CLEANOZ is: Fast and effective: The gentle suction quickly and efficiently clears nasal passages in seconds. Easy to use: Cleanoz features a dolphin-shaped, ergonomic handle so it's comfortable to hold. Best of all, the nozzles are disposable making Cleanoz a sanitary solution. AND it saves time, since there's no need to clean it after each use. Gentle: Cleanoz is specially designed for use on delicate infants and young children. The flexible silicone nozzle tips are soft and comfortable. Safe: The Cleanoz disposable nozzle tips have been tested by the North American Science Association, Inc (NASMA). In addition, a protective screw secures the battery pack and the dolphin-shaped design features round edges for additional safety.

Works well, but not a miracle worker
 
Review Date: July 7, 2009
Reviewer: HMM, Atlanta, GA United States
I used this with my 1-year-old son last winter, and it worked pretty well. It was absolutely necessary to use saline solution a few minutes before suctioning. The suction is very gentle so the mucus needs to be thinned before using the aspirator. The motor is kind of loud and made my son wary of it (although he was more upset about having to be still). Overall I found it to be a step up from the bulb syringe, but not a miracle tool.

Completely Useless
 
Review Date: January 21, 2009
Reviewer: Bob's Opinion, Upland, CA
This product does not preform as easily and efficiently as the manufacturer states. The major problem is that it only allows for a short blast of suction. And by "short" I mean only 2 seconds at best. And the suction level is incredibly low; no where near enough to get the job done the way they say it should. I get better results from the the bulb aspirator we brought home from the hospital.

The design is uncomfortable and awkward; it makes you work at angles that don't come naturally. I'm not sure what they mean by "dolphin" design other than the look. Why they feel this shape should make things easier is beyond me. But whatever the reason...don't be fooled into thinking this is some kind of revolutionary design concept. The fact is the aspirator doesn't fit naturally or comfortably into your hand or your baby's nose.

And last, the "disposable reservoir nozzle" is nothing more than a plastic tip with a water balloon attached to it. And when I say, "water balloon" that's what I mean. They have taken an actual water balloon and attached it to the removable nozzle and that is where the waste from your baby's nose is suppose to get sucked into. Look closely at the picture; those pink things attached to the tips are the water balloons. As the vacuum (and I use that term loosely) sucks air, it draws air into the water balloon and when the balloon expands enough it then plugs the hole of the vacuum, essentially stopping the suction from going any further. That's how they stop the aspirator from actually going long enough to suck anything of consequence out of your baby's nose.

Very disappointed in the product, but even more disappointed in myself for being fooled by their play on words in advertising. My bad for falling for it.
Complete Waste of Money
 
Review Date: March 21, 2010
Reviewer: Smart Shopper, Georgia
I have tried to use this several times on my 4 month old since he developed nightly congestion that was causing him to stay awake. I liked the idea that each tip is only used once, which seems more hygenic than other models. When using the device, the inflatable balloon that is supposed to catch the mucus fills up the chamber within 2 seconds of beginning suction. Once that is done, you must squeeze the tip to release the air. It took 10-15 times of repeating this process to get a noticeable amount of mucus in the balloon. Also, if mucus clogs the tip, it is hard to deflate the balloon and mucus comes out of the tip (so much for a hygenic product when that happens). I went back to the bulb syringe provided by the hospital, but I am back at Amazon today looking for another solution. My husband calls me the "gadget queen". I guess I lived up to my name on this one, but it is more gimmick than gadget. Wish I had saved my money.
